What is an IOLTA Trust Account?

An IOLTA (Interest on Lawyers’ Trust Accounts) is a special type of trust account that holds client funds. The interest earned is used to fund legal aid programs.

Why is IOLTA Important?

IOLTA accounts help attorneys manage client funds while ensuring compliance with legal regulations. They protect both the attorney and the client.
